Operator Adjustment
See table below and diagrams (page 10) for operator feature adjustment.
After adjusting, cycle the door several times to check for proper operation.
NOTE
Adjust Operator for the SLOWEST operation practical, in accordance with
the latest revisions of the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A); ANSI/BHMA
A156.19 Standards for Power-Assisted and Low Energy Power-Operated Doors;
and local codes.
Opening Speed: 5 seconds or more
Latch Location: 10 degrees or more
Closing Speed: 3 seconds or more
Latch Speed: 1.5 seconds or more
